Description:

This method provides a procedure for determination of chlorophylls a (chl a) and b (chl b) found in marine and freshwater phytoplankton. Reversed phase high performance liquid chromatography (HPLC) with detection at 440 nm is used to separate the pigments from a complex pigment mixture and measure them in the sub-microgram range. For additional reference, other taxonomically important yet commercially unavailable pigments of interest are identified by retention time.
